What percentage of body weight is lifted during push-up?

What percentage of body weight is lifted during push-up?

As detailed, in a standard push-up, you press roughly 64\% of your body weight. Elevating your feet increases the percentage of body weight you press (up to 74\% when the feet are elevated 60 centimeters).

How much am I benching when I do a push-up?

For a 140-pound person doing a modified push-up, he or she would be lifting: Approximately 75 pounds of his/her bodyweight in the up position….How much weight is really lifted during a push-up?

Modified Push-up Full Push-up
Up Position 53.56\% bodyweight supported 69.16\% bodyweight supported
Down Position 61.80\% bodyweight supported 75.04\% bodyweight supported

What percentage of your body weight do you lift with push ups?

Push-Up Weight Distribution Percentages. In a regular push-up, you lift 64 percent of body weight, whereas with a knee push-up, you lift 49 percent. If you’re new to training, performing the push-up with hands elevated on a 24-inch bench will allow you to lift even less than a knee push-up, at 41 percent of body weight.

How effective are push-ups?

Coincedently, Charles Poliquin also posted something about the efficacy of push-ups. A new study in the Journal of Strength and Conditioning Research identified the percent of body weight you lift with four varieties of the push-up. In a regular push-up, you lift 64 percent of body weight, whereas with a knee push-up, you lift 49 percent.
